| The internal interface is SATA The external interface is USB 2.0 or SATA. The only thing that I see is the harddrive that you got is a SATA 2 with 300gbs, and the metal gear enclosure is only a SATA 1 at 150gbs. Not really a big deal though, as most of the SATA 2's don't hit anywhere near there supposed speeds. | ||||||||||||||

The only thing that it will do, it limit the drive to 150gb/s transfer rate. That is still faster than the IDE UDMA 6 that transfer at 133gb/s. It should be a great external hard drive And Metal Gear Box is great enclosures by the way.
